The nearest airport is San Diego International Airport (SAN), just 15 minutes by car from San Diego Zoo.
Stay in nearby upscale hotels in downtown San Diego or charming boutique stays in Balboa Park vicinity.
Combine your visit with a stroll through Balboa Park, a harbor cruise, or exploring nearby museums in San Diego.
